Description
The product with the part number 194923E-02L falls under the category of Automotive Networking Products. It is a model PXI-8512, known for its capability as a Dual Port, CAN/HS, Series 3, Dual Port 9 Pin DSUB device. This product offers alternatives with part numbers 780687-01 for a single port option and 780687-02 for those requiring two ports.
Depending on the specific part number, the device can have either 1 or 2 ports. It utilizes a CAN (Controller Area Network) interface, ensuring robust communication for automotive applications. The PXI-8512 supports various protocols including CAN, LIN, and FlexRay, making it versatile for different automotive networking needs.
This model is capable of handling up to 192 hardware-accelerated frames, enhancing its efficiency in data processing. It supports several database formats such as FIBEX, CANdb (.DBC), LDF, and NI-CAN NCD, offering flexibility in data management and integration. The PXI-8512 is compatible with Windows and LabVIEW Real-Time operating systems, ensuring it can be integrated into a wide range of development environments.
Among its special features, the PXI-8512 includes NI RTSI synchronization support, a DMA engine for reduced latency, and integrated NI-XNET utilities.
